After winning $1.36 million from an arbitrator in an attorney fee dispute, Fish & Richardson recently filed a lawsuit in a Dallas district court in an attempt to confirm the award and get their former clients to pay up.

But a lawyer who now represents Fish’s ex-clients said that they plan to object to the conformation of the award, one they believe is “not meritorious at all.”
